A guaranty bond is a three-party contract in between you (the principal), the surety company that backs the bond financially, and the obligee.

A guaranty bond enables you to obtain a kind of debt without having to publish a huge amount of cash or assets that might not come in case of a claim. This is a much more practical and also cost-efficient way of taking care of state and also obligee requirements than having to upload a substantial sum of money upfront or bind your service's future capability to borrow cash.

Building and construction Bonds


Building Bonds are a means to secure the job proprietor from monetary losses and make sure that the professional completes the job on schedule. They are usually utilized on public jobs such as infrastructure and ports.

A Building Bond is released by a surety bond agency, which runs comprehensive history and monetary examine the specialist before approving the bond. If the contractor fails to comply with the regards to the agreement, the obligee can make a claim versus the building bond.

The building bond is made to provide monetary assurance that the project will be finished in a timely manner and with the finest standards. However, it can additionally be utilized to recoup losses triggered by an insolvency or a specialist's failing to follow the regards to their contract.

Contractor Bonds


A Specialist Bond is a type of surety assurance made use of in the building market. It is a lawful arrangement between 3 events: the obligee (usually a job owner), the principal and a guaranty.

The obligee requires the bond as a means to protect itself from financial losses that might happen because of a contractor's failure to finish their contractual responsibilities. Upon violation, the obligee has the right to make a case versus the bond and also the principal should pay that claim back.

Court Bonds


Court bonds are judicial guaranty bonds utilized to guarantee protection from loss in court process. They can be required by complainants and also offenders in cases entailing building, estates or fiduciary obligation.

The primary objective of court bonds is to minimize threat, which includes the opportunity of one party disposing of opposed residential property prior to the result of the situation has actually been made as well as the opportunity of court costs not being paid. Probate Bonds


Probate Bonds (likewise called fiduciary bonds, estate bonds, and also executor bonds) are made use of to make sure that the individual designated to execute a will executes their tasks in a lawful fashion. Failure to do so may bring about monetary loss for the heirs of the estate.

Probates are court-supervised processes that disperse the possessions of a deceased individual among their successors. Typically this process is detailed in the individual's will.

In some states, a personal agent of an estate is needed to buy a probate bond. However, a will or trust can waive the requirement and permit the executor to prevent obtaining a bond.
